Re: Retirement of the Stonebriar product line

Stonebriar sales have declined for five consecutive quarters and support costs now exceed contribution margin. The retirement plan is staged: new orders close end of Q2, existing contracts honoured through their terms, and spares stocked for twenty-four months. Sales leads should steer prospects toward the Ashgrove range; migration incentives are already approved. Customer comms are drafted and awaiting legal sign-off. The forward strategy behind this decision is set out in the note below.

confidential, yafog-hagug: Gross margin on Druix came in at 10 percent against a plan of 15 percent. Only 5 of the 80 pilot accounts renewed Druix, so a churn review is set for October 1.

Slimcask strips debug symbols, locale data, and package caches from base images before promotion. Every slimmed image must be traceable to its fat parent. Provenance record includes: parent digest, strip manifest, builder version, and timestamp.

Do not slim images by hand. Only the Oxbarrow CI runner is authorized to sign provenance attestations. If the attestation is missing, the registry rejects promotion — no exceptions.

Each attestation closes with a build token; the one for the current pipeline release appears below.

build token for kagaf-hahof: htk14_9d3d4d26d7d8de

# Env file — Cartwheel dispatch, driver-assignment heuristic
# Scope: staging only. Do not promote to prod.
# The heuristic weights (proximity, shift balance, refusal rate) are tuned
# for the Velmont pilot region and will misbehave elsewhere.
# Review notes: heuristic service runs unprivileged; it reads weights
# read-only from the tuning store and writes nothing back.
# Only one sensitive value exists in this file: the tuning-store access
# credential, consumed at boot and never logged.
# That credential is set on the following line.

secret setting of faduf-bahop: LEDGER_TOKEN8=c3b363be

Leadership Review Briefing — Sales Leads

The Strataline product family retires end of Q4. No new orders after October; support runs 12 months post-sale. Migration path is the Vantor series, with trade-in credits for contracts over two years. Expect pushback from the Kellenford accounts. Talking points issued next week. The rationale, for your eyes only, follows below.

internal memo for hahaf-kahof: Only 39 of the 428 pilot accounts renewed Sorion, so a churn review is set for April 12. Praokix Freight is in early talks to buy Queniusox Group for about $145.8 million.